Comparison review

The Motorola One Hyper is just a bit better than the Galaxy S7 edge, with a overall score of 79.8 against 78.1. The Motorola One Hyper is a extremely newer phone than the Galaxy S7 edge, but it's heavier and thicker. Both devices we compare here have Android OS (Operating System), but Motorola One Hyper has 11 version and Galaxy S7 edge has Android 8.0 Oreo.

Galaxy S7 edge features just a bit better looking screen than Motorola One Hyper, because although it has a little smaller screen, it also counts with a better 1440 x 2560 pixels resolution and a higher pixel density. Motorola One Hyper counts with a much greater storage capacity for apps and games than Galaxy S7 edge, because it has 96 GB more internal storage and a SD extension slot that holds up to 1000 GB.

The Motorola One Hyper has just a bit better hardware performance than Samsung Galaxy S7 edge, and although they both have the same RAM memory amount, the Motorola One Hyper also has more cores. The Motorola One Hyper features a better camera than Galaxy S7 edge, because although it has a smaller camera aperture which is not good for shooting photographs or videos in low-light situations, and they both have the same video frame rate and the same video definition, the Motorola One Hyper also counts with a camera in the back with a lot higher resolution.

The Motorola One Hyper counts with just a little bit longer battery duration than Galaxy S7 edge, because it has an 11% greater battery size.

Motorola One Hyper costs a little more than the Galaxy S7 edge, but you can get a better phone for that extra dollars.
